General Summary

Noon - Freeday - 14 Ready'reat

  Within the Barracks of Saltmarsh, Wee Jane states that she worked for the Agile Hand. Fireborn takes a hard look at Wee Jane before asking, "You worked for the Agile Hand?!"   Wee Jane responds, "Ya. I mean maybe worked for is a bit too strong a word. I've done a few jobs for them and they stiffed me on the last job. I'd love to pay them back so to speak."   Fireborn relaxes a bit as he continues, "So you know a little bit about them and where they call home. Good. That'll help this lot out. Do you want to, umm, interview our guest?"  
Jane grins wickedly as she nods, "Yes! I definitely want to ask this person a few questions." She follows Fireborn downstairs to the cell at the end and immediately lays into the prisoner named Grinky, "What's with the map? I'm not understanding what floor is what. There are definitely three floors, but you are only showing two."   Cowering back deeper into the cell, his voice quivers, "I drew three floors. The Basement, ground level, and a second story."   "How many people?" Karia demands.   "Uh.. Ten to fifteen at any given time, I guess," Grinky answers.   Jane blurts, "Are you a member?"   "No," he responds, "They aren't taking new members these days, but I've worked with them since I was a teen."   Karia quickly pulls his attention back, "Are they well armed?"   "I'm not sure. It's so hard to be certain," he muses, "Guildmaster Dusk seems to run openly within Redshore regardless of the city guard. Does that mean she's got an arsenal behind her? Or does she have some other power or powers at her beck and call?"   Well, you're just a font of details!" Jane says in a huff before leading the party out of the jail. As they step outside into the cold wintery air, she asks, "What the hell game is he playing. Saying he's helping without giving any real information."   Adlia commiserates, "Some people just like to talk and this would be a way for him to reduce his punishment."   Karia feeling frustrated vents, "Well! I guess the Try-hard misfits are off to find this painting because it's sooo important. Ugh! This feels like gofer work. However, if we're going to do this, we should stock up on healing potions. Kyra, you've got a contact where we could purchase some?"   Kyra answers, "Maybe. I can certainly go ask. I'll meet up with you all at the Snapping Line for lunch." Kyra then heads south toward the Empty Net and the Faithful Quartermasters of Iuz.   As the rest of the party heads toward down the town's square, Jane continues, "Grinky was definitely holding back. I've been to the Agile Hand's headquarters. I've seen the outside. He was definitely missing at least one floor and there are more guards than he notated and definitely more people around. I don't know what he's trying to achieve, but we can't trust his information. Anyhow, how are we getting to Redshore? Does your group own a ship?"   "I own two actually," Nar quips, "Well we all do that is. However, we need a captain to run the ship. Let's head down to the docks and find O'Donahue." Upon reaching Captain O'Donahue's fishing vessel Nar calls out, "O captain my captain! What do you have going on today?" Several minutes pass without a reply before she turns to Karia, "hmm he must not be on the ship. Where else could he be?"   Karia replies, "He could be spending time with his family. Do you know where he lives?"   Nar shakes her head, "No. I guess we'll just head back to the inn and get lunch."   Upon entering the Snapping Line, the part sees Jimmy Jr, Capt O'Donahue's right-hand man, sitting at a table with a few others. Karia heads over and greets him, "Hey Jimmy Jr! I want to proposition you!"   Jimmy smirks, "Oh!? That sounds, umm, exciting!"   Blushing Karia responds, "I mean we need to hire you and O'Donahue for a trip. Do you know where O'Donahue lives and can we head over?"   "Well, that's a problem. Mrs O doesn't like the adventuring types," replies Jimmy Jr. "She thinks your kind causes chaos and trouble wherever you go. I doubt she'd be pleased if you just show up at his doorstep."   "Great!" Nar quips, "I'll let the captain know my desire to be friends with his wife, then she'll like us and it won't be a problem!"   "Umm," hedges Jimmy, "I'm not sure how well that will go either. How about I go let him know that you all have another trip planned and see what we can do?" Jimmy then stands up drops a few coins on the table and heads outside.   Adlia states, "I'm off to temple so we can tithe Procan for fair winds."   A few hours later, the party approaches Primewater Mansion where the butler grants them entry and escorts them upstairs to a most irked Councillor Primewater's office. As he finishes crossly scribbling out a note, he looks up and greets the party, "Hail! I see the glorious misfits have heard word of the rude and unpatriotic pilfering of my precious painting! I fear someone's out to sully my good name with his majesty, and after I went through all that trouble to showcase my dedication to the crown, it is truly reprehensible behavior by those charlatans! I'm certain you must be here after hearing of this despicable crime and to help salvage my good name as one of the utmost citizens of Saltmarsh."   Nar begins, "You know costs these days are crazy, so we came here. We want to know what it's worth to you."   "Of course, good lady Nar, let not mere trifles such as this stand in the way of justice! After all, this is not just some random work of art, but a piece donated by yours truly to the town of Saltmarsh, to remind all councilors of the august visage of his majesty! Surely word of its beauty would have spread far and wide as well as," Primewater winks knowingly and says in a conspiratory tone, "a certain councilor's dedication to the royal family, eh?" After a moment of a far-off look of joy in his eyes, his mind returns from the clouds and his expression sours and in a dejected tone he continues, "How can this be allowed to happen! It's not right and I--er I mean *we* cannot stand for it!"   Nar clarifies, "We understand your position, but the problem more lies with finding people. Everyone is doing weird Freeday rituals, like spending time with their family."   "Oh!" Primewater exclaims, "But don't you have your own ship? Couldn't you be loading it right now and making all haste?"   Jane speaks up, "Um. We need a captain and for that we need an advance. The captain and his crew require getting paid, you see."   "Ah! Of course, I understand," Primewater responds, "After all, economics is the life-blood of any town. That's easy enough, surely for this service to the town, I can authorize you to draw on a bit of our coffers to fund your journey." Pulling an abacus out of somewhere you don't care to image, he begins to muse, "Let's see, perhaps fifty-five gold a day? I suppose that will end up around four hundred forty gold for your expenses?" With that he quickly returns to his desk and writes, signs, and dates an official letter of credit to the town coffers, and affixes a wax seal emblazoned with the Saltmarsh town council seal granting the misfits the right to withdrawl the amount necessary.   The party quickly agrees and accepts the letter from Primewater, stopping to cash it along the way back to the Snapping Line. As they look for a table, the party sees Capt O'Donahue sitting with Jimmy Jr waving them over. The group quickly agrees to heading out tomorrow for hopefully a seven or eight day round trip and the party should be ready to sail by the morning tide. The party enjoys a meal and several hours of hanging out in the tavern before heading to their rooms.  

Starday - 15 Ready'reat

 
The party rises early and heads toward their sailing vessel the Seaghost where Capt O'Donahue has already loaded it and rigged it waiting for the tide to turn. Coming aboard, the party quickly resumes the roles they've learned with Kyra checking the weather, Nar strumming on her lute, Karia climbs the mast, Adlia starts plotting a course, and Jane starts coiling the lines. Within hours the Seaghost finds heads eastward on open waters. A couple days pass with the wintery weather blowing squalls, but the ship keeps her heading, mostly, and continues on course to Redshore.  

Godsday - 18 Ready'reat

  The third day dawns with the sun hidden behind dark stormy clouds, but these pass eastward without unleashing their power.  
Karia shouts out a warning as three figures leap out of the water. One immediately attacks Wee Jane on the bow, while another lands at midships and then runs up the ladder to flank Jane. The third attacks Adlia on the starboard midships deck.  
Kyra leaps upward as her boots sprout wings taking her out of range while weaving arcane engergies into a scorching ray blasting the Sahuagin near Adlia. Jane feels deep cuts as both of her sahuagin attackers breach her defenses as she then retorts with her blade swishing forth. Nar fires arrows into one and then moves in to flank it against Jane. From the crows nest, Karia showers arrows down upon the bow. Adlia hearing her compatriot cry out in pain calls upon the blessings of Ehlonna providing succor to Jane.  
The battle wages hotly as both sides seek retribution upon the other, but then following a strike from Jane, one of the sahuagin blademasters leaps for the open ocean, but Jane instantly reacts and slices its head clean. The body falls to the deck as coins scatter forth.   Feeling the tide turning against them, the other two sahuagin make a strategic retreat leaving echoes of steel ringing against steel behind.   The party heaves a huge sigh of relief as Adlia calls upon Ehlonna for healing. Within an hour, the docks of Redshore come into view.
